Dive Brief:
- Tesco Plc's CEO Dave Lewis announced some major twists for the company that's seen its share of difficulties, including the shuttering of 43 stores.
- Tesco's headquarters will no longer be at Cheshunt, a location it has retained for more than 40 years.
- Additionally, Tesco revealed Matt Davies of Halfords Group Plc will take the reins as Tesco's new UK CEO.
Dive Insight:
The details of Tesco's change-ups are finally here. These changes can't come as too much of a surprise, though Eurofruit referred to Davies' appointment as "unexpected." As we've noted before, if Tesco wants to make some kind of comeback, it isn't necessarily going to be easy.
